Russian Drones Violate Latvian Airspace and Crash Near Rezekne Oil Facility
Latvian National Armed Forces reported that multiple drones originating from Russia entered Latvian airspace early on May 7, 2026. One drone crashed near an oil storage facility in the eastern city of Rezekne, while a search continues for a second potential crash site. Latvian authorities classified the incident as an 'emergency situation' and a violation of sovereignty. This intrusion occurs amid heightened regional tensions and increased NATO surveillance following similar airspace violations in Poland and Romania earlier this year.
